Earlier we used the same interrupt budget always and waited for higher number of ticks when tiering up from Turboprop to TurboFan. On some of the real world pages this adds a reasonable overhead for processing these interrupts. This cl sets the interrupt budget to a higher value so there are fewer interrupts. This cl: 1. Sets the interrupt budget on feedback cell to FLAG_interrupt_budget * scale factor when we install optimized code. 2. Resets the budget to FLAG_interrupt_budget when there is a deoptimization. 3. Updates the runtime profiler to remove the scaling of number of ticks needed for optimization when tiering up from TP to TF. On sheets benchmark, we spend 40-50ms when servicing interrupts from Turboprop code. This change brings it down to ~7ms. We also see improvements on other pages. The compiler is only interested in the contents if it contains a FeedbackVector. If one is discovered, it is serialized, and we ensure we'll either return it or nothing if the contents of the cell changed on the main thread. FeedbackCells can be reset if the bytecode for the associated function is flushed. We have guarantees only for functions we choose to inline that this doesn't happen (by holding a strong handle to the SharedFunctionInfo). Construction of JSFunction objects is complex, mostly due to the existence of multiple functions kinds (JS, wasm, builtin, test, ...) that are all created slightly differently. For example, JS functions may come with an existing FeedbackCell (and FeedbackVector), while builtins and wasm functions always use the many_closures_cell (without a vector). Prior to this CL, construction logic was scattered over a family of 7 functions, without a clearly defined chokepoint for header initialization. This was hard to understand, hard to modify, and needlessly inefficient (by setting some fields twice). This CL fixes all that by introducing JSFunctionBuilder. The BuildRaw method is the chokepoint for allocation and initialization, and Build performs common pre- and post-work. Future work: - Remove now-deprecated functions. - Untangle SFI/Map/JSFunction construction and remove Factory::NewFunction and NewFunctionArgs. This CL splits the class definitions per .tq file, to realize the following relationship: A class defined in src/objects/foo.tq has a C++ definition in src/objects/foo.h. Torque then generates: - torque-generated/src/objects/foo-tq.inc An include file (no proper header) to be included in src/objects/foo.h containing the Torque-generated C++ class definition. - torque-generated/src/objects/foo-tq-inl.inc An include file (no proper header) to be included in src/objects/foo-inl.h containing inline function definitions. - torque-generated/src/objects/foo-tq.cc A source file including src/objects/foo-inl.h that contains non-inline function definitions. Advantages of this approach: - Avoid big monolithic headers and preserve the work that went into splitting objects.h - Moving a definition to Torque keeps everything in the same place from a C++ viewpoint, including a fully Torque-generated C++ class definition. - The Torque-generated include files do not need to be independent headers, necessary includes or forward declarations can just be added to the headers that include them. Drive-by changes: A bunch of definitions and files had to be moved or created to realize a consistent 1:1 relationship between .tq files and C++ headers. We use the same interrupt to both allocate feedback vectors and for updating the profiler ticks. If there is a feedback vector already available, we just increment the profiler ticks that we use to mark for optimizing function. Calling JSFunction::EnsureFeedbackVector allocates a feedback vector, but doesn't reset the budget, so we optimize much earlier than expected. This is currently only a problem with %PrepareFunctionForOptimize that doesn't reset the budget. Other code paths do also reset the interrupt budget. When bytecode is flushed we also want to flush the feedback vectors to save memory. There was a bug in this code and we flushed ClosureFeedbackCellArray too. Flushing ClosureFeedbackCellArrays causes the closures created by this function before and after the bytecode flush to have different feedback cells and hence different feedback vectors. This cl fixes it so we only flush feedback vectors on a bytecode flush. Also this cl pretenures ClosureFeedbackCellArrays. Only FeedbackCells and FeedbackVectors can contain ClosureFeedbackCellArrays which are pretenured, so it is better to pretenure ClosureFeedbackCellArrays as well. Interrupt budget was store in bytecode array and used to be shared across all contexts. With lazy feedback allocation, using context independent interrupt budget might lead to performance cliffs when we have closures that do not share the same feedback (for ex: across contexts). This would be a problem even earlier but it could be more pronounced with feedback vector allocation, since the budgets for optimization is much higher (144x) than the budget for feedback allocation.
